Understanding Unsized Text

When it comes to digital design and typography, the concept of "unsized text" often comes into play. Essentially, unsized text refers to text elements that do not have a set font size defined by the designer. Instead, these text elements inherit their font size from their parent element or are influenced by the user's browser settings.

Benefits of Using Unsized Text

One of the main benefits of using unsized text is its flexibility. By allowing text elements to adapt to their parent containers or user preferences, designers can create more responsive and user-friendly layouts. Unsized text can adjust to different screen sizes and resolutions, ensuring a consistent and readable experience across devices.

Moreover, unsized text can enhance accessibility. Users with visual impairments or specific font size preferences can benefit from the dynamic nature of unsized text, as it allows them to adjust the text size according to their needs. This can improve the overall usability and inclusivity of a website or application.

Challenges of Using Unsized Text

While unsized text offers numerous advantages, it can also present challenges for designers. Without specific font sizes set for text elements, the overall visual hierarchy of the design may be less clear. Designers need to rely on other visual cues and design principles to ensure that important information stands out and is easily readable.

Additionally, when relying on unsized text, designers need to consider how different browsers and devices may interpret font sizes. The lack of precise control over text sizes can sometimes lead to inconsistencies in the display of text across various platforms.

Best Practices for Using Unsized Text

To make the most of unsized text in your designs, consider the following best practices:

  • Use em and rem units for font sizes to ensure scalability and flexibility.
  • Avoid nesting too many levels of unsized text, as it can complicate the readability and maintainability of the design.
  • Test your designs across different browsers and devices to identify any potential issues with text sizing and readability.

By following these best practices, you can harness the power of unsized text to create more adaptive and user-centric designs while mitigating potential challenges.
